LeoLiar905 bannerLeoLiar905 banner
LeoLiar905LeoLiar905

LeoLiar905

Unknown@leoliar905  •  Joined March 13, 2009

Live
Sub 77.0K  |  View 53.0M  |  Video 21
#540,853
#306,496

Projections — Coming soon

This section is under development. Check back later.